菜鸟教程 https://www.runoob.com/linux/linux-comm-export.html
Linux export 命令用于设置或显示环境变量。
在 shell 中执行程序时,shell 会提供一组环境变量。export 可新增,修改或删除环境变量,供后续执行的程序使用。export 的效力仅限于该次登陆操作。
export [-fnp][变量名称]=[变量设置值]
一般用于交叉编译。
设置环境变量例子:
export ARCH=arm
export CROSS_COMPILE=arm-linux-gnueabihfexport PATH=$PATH:<WORKDIR>/Toolchain/
export PATH=$PATH:<WORKDIR>/Toolchain/
显示变量:
比如$HOME ,$PATH 代表啥意思,可以使用export 查看变量值
echo $HOME
得到:/home/liu 表示的就是用户家目录
echo $PATH
得到:/home/liu/bin:/home/liu/.local/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/usr/local/games:/home/liu/share/gateway/04-Linux_source/Toolchain/gcc-5.3.0/bin:/snap/bin:/home/liu/share/gateway/04-Linux_source/Toolchain/gcc-5.3.0/bin